Try 'su - backup -c "newgrp disk"' and see if 'su - backup -c "id"' shows disk then.
Thanks, Chris > -----Original Message----- > From: [EMAIL PROTECTED] > [mailto:[EMAIL PROTECTED] On Behalf > Of Nathan R. Valentine > Sent: Monday, 20 June, 2005 11:21 > To: Bacula-users@lists.sourceforge.net > Subject: RE: [Bacula-users] autochanger problems. > > > I'm sort of at a loss here: > > backup:/etc/bacula/scripts# grep bacula /etc/group > disk:x:6:bacula > tape:x:26:bacula > bacula:x:102: > changer:x:106:bacula > > backup:/etc/bacula/scripts# ls -l /dev/nst0 > crw-rw---- 1 root tape 9, 128 Jun 16 13:21 /dev/nst0 > > backup:/etc/bacula/scripts# ls -l /dev/sg1 > crw-rw---- 1 root disk 21, 1 Jun 16 13:21 /dev/sg1 > > backup:/etc/bacula/scripts# su - backup -c "id" > uid=34(backup) gid=34(backup) groups=34(backup) > > backup:/etc/bacula/scripts# su - backup -c > "/etc/bacula/scripts/mtx-changer /dev/sg1 loaded 13 /dev/nst0 0" > + MTX=mtx > + test 5 -lt 2 > + ctl=/dev/sg1 > + cmd=loaded > + slot=13 > + device=/dev/nst0 > + test 5 = 5 > + drive=0 > + case $cmd in > + case $cmd in > + mtx -f /dev/sg1 status > cannot open SCSI device '/dev/sg1' - Permission denied > > backup:/etc/bacula/scripts# grep 'ARGS=' /etc/init.d/bacula-sd > ARGS="-c /etc/bacula/bacula-sd.conf -u bacula -g disk" > > It appears as though the bacula user isn't picking up the 'disk' group > membership?!? > > -- > --- > Nathan Valentine, CISSP - [EMAIL PROTECTED] > Open Source Technician > Venn Technologies, Inc. : http://www.venntech.net > ------------------------------------------------------- SF.Net email is sponsored by: Discover Easy Linux Migration Strategies from IBM. Find simple to follow Roadmaps, straightforward articles, informative Webcasts and more! Get everything you need to get up to speed, fast. http://ads.osdn.com/?ad_id=7477&alloc_id=16492&op=click _______________________________________________ Bacula-users mailing list Bacula-users@lists.sourceforge.net https://lists.sourceforge.net/lists/listinfo/bacula-users